OpenAI expands $500 billion Stargate Project to U.S. for AI infrastructure. This move strengthens AI development in the U.S. Key partners include Oracle and SoftBank with government backing. OpenAI has announced the expansion of its $500 billion Stargate Project to the United States as of May 7, 2025, supported by high-profile partners. This significant expansion marks a strategic shift towards enhancing U.S. AI capabilities, affirming global technological leadership. OpenAI’s $500B Stargate: A U.S. Technological Leap Stargate Project, launched in January 2025, is a collaborative effort involving OpenAI CEO Sam Altman and the Trump administration , alongside Oracle and SoftBank. OpenAI has committed $500 billion towards bolstering AI infrastructure, a move that aligns with U.S. interests in maintaining leadership in AI technology. “The Stargate Project is a transformative initiative that will redefine AI infrastructure on a global scale.” — Sam Altman, CEO, OpenAI . The project aims to build expansive data center facilities, initially focusing on U.S. development but now transitioning to a global scale. Energy needs are significant, with solutions like solar, nuclear, and carbon capture being explored. U.S. President Donald Trump has lauded the investment as a “ declaration of confidence ” in American AI capabilities. OpenAI Vice President Chris Lehan stated the expansion will exceed financial expectations in the U.S., highlighting optimistic economic implications.
